About San Pelayo
San Pelayo is a town located in Colombia, in the Córdoba region. With a recorded population of 5,637,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, San Pelayo lies at coordinates 8.96°N, 75.84°W, placing it in the Northern Western Hemisphere. The city operates on the America/Bogota tim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
